4:20 pm : On the heels of last week's strong performance, Monday's market took a breather. The major averages traded in mixed, tightly range-bound fashion for most of the session, and they kept within close proximity of the unchanged mark. The Dow and S&P booked modest losses, while the Nasdaq registered a moderate gain.

1:51 pm PT Phillips-Van Heusen beats by $0.04, light on revs; guides Y06 EPS in line (PVH) : Reports Q4 (Jan) earnings of $0.41 per share, $0.04 better than the Reuters Estimates consensus of $0.37; revenues rose 11.2% year/year to $460.1 mln vs the $473.1 mln consensus. Co issues in-line guidance for FY07, sees EPS of $2.16-2.22, ex items�vs. $2.17 consensus.
1:42 pm PT Shuffle Master beats by $0.02, beats on revs; reiterates Y06 guidance (SHFL) 26.23 +0.25 : Reports Q1 (Jan) earnings of $0.23 per share, $0.02 better than the Reuters Estimates consensus of $0.21; revenues rose 31.3% year/year to $33.3 mln vs the $31.3 mln consensus. Co issues upside guidance for FY06, sees EPS of $1.02-1.05 vs. $1.02 consensus. Consistent with previous guidance, mgmt is targeting ~25% growth in quarter-over-quarter fiscal 2006 EPS (EPS guidance excludes the adoption of FAS 123R and any contribution from the recently announced Stargames acquisition, which it anticipates will be neutral to slightly accretive to fiscal 2006 EPS)
